§ 88800

Added by Stats. 2015, Ch. 22, Sec. 20. (SB 81) Effective June 24, 2015.

A financial and professional development grant funding program, administered by the Chancellor of the California Community Colleges, is hereby established. The chancellor shall distribute multiyear grants, upon appropriation by the Legislature, to the governing boards of community college districts pursuant to applications that satisfy the requirements of this part. Moneys allocated pursuant to this program shall be expended for community colleges within a district that receives a grant to adopt or expand the use of evidence-based models of academic assessment and placement, remediation, and student support that accelerate the progress of underprepared students toward achieving postsecondary educational and career goals.
